List Editing Using a Copy Reference 

Use

If you want to represent a location structure that already exists in the system in a similar form, you can use this structure as a copy reference. In this way you are able to:

Procedure

  1. In the main menu, choose Logistics ® Plant maintenance ® Technical objects.
  2. The screen Technical Objects is displayed.

  3. Then choose
  4. – for functional locations:

    Then use the menu bar sequence FunctLocation ® List editing ® Create.

    – for reference functional locations:

    FunctLocation ® Reference location ® List editing ® Create.

    In both cases you go to the List Entry screen.

  5. Enter the structure indicator that you want to use. Then choose Edit ® Copy reference.
  6. The dialog box Copy Functional Location Structure is displayed.

  7. Enter the label of the location you want to use as a copy reference in this dialog box.
  8. Enter the label of the functional location that is to be at the top of the new structure in the field New FunctLocStruct.
  9. You now have two options:
  10. – You copy all locations of this structure

    To do this, choose Continue.

    The system enters all the location labels and texts in the entry list. The labels have already been changed according to the new location structure specified.

    – You display the structure of the copy reference and select the locations that you want to copy.

    To do this, choose either Structure list or Structure graphic.

    In both cases, the location hierarchy, that you can break down further as required, is displayed.

    Flag the locations that you would like to copy and choose Edit ® Select. You return to the List Editing screen.

    The system enters all the labels and texts of the selected locations in the entry list. The labels have already been changed in accordance with the new location structure, and possibly adapted to suit the new structure indicator.

  11. Change the functional location texts as required.
  12. Save the new functional locations.
